Arşive Gönderirken Onar ve Sıkıştır Yapamıyorum
Tarih
26/04/2009 19:06
Konu Sahibi
kahraman701
Yorumlar
7
Okunma
2412
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y



kahraman701
Üye
Kullanici Avatari
Üye
21
7
08/11/2008
0
Ankara
Ofis XP
05/02/2012,19:27
Çözüldü 
Arkadaşlar verileri arşive göndermek için aşağıdaki kodu kullanıyorum. Verileri göndermede sorun yok ancak en alt bölümde yer alan onarma ve şıkıştırmaya yarayan komut çalışmıyor şöyle bir uyarı veriyor "bir makro veya visual basic kodu çalıştırırken açık veritabanını sıkıştıramazsınız" bu konuda yardımcı olursanız sevinirim

Kod:
1
2
3
4
5
6
7
8
9
Private Sub Komut47_Click()
D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er70
DoCmd.RunSQL "insert into ArşivT select * from VeriT Where VeriT.Kimlik=[Forms]![VeriF]![Kimlik]"
DoCmd.RunSQL "delete  from veriT Where VeriT.Kimlik=[Forms]![VeriF]![Kimlik]"
Me.Requery
DoCmd.GoToRecord , , acNewRec
DoCmd.ShowToolbar ("Menü Çubuğu"), acToolbarYes
Application.CommandBars.FindControl(ID:=2071).accDoDefaultAction
End Sub

Cevapla


mehmetdemiral
.
Kullanici Avatari
Uzman
M.... D....
4.734
30/10/2008
Samsun
Ofis 2013 Tr. 32 Bit
05/12/2016,11:17
Çözüldü 
Sıkıştırma komutunu yeni kayıttan sonra değil önce kullansanız. Bir de öyle deneyin. Hatta ilk önce sıkıştır ve onarı kullanın sonra arşive gönderin, sora yeni kayıt açın.

Kod:
1
2
3
4
5
6
7
8
9
10
11
Private Sub Komut47_Click()

DoCmd.ShowToolbar ("Menü Çubuğu"), acToolbarYes
Application.CommandBars.FindControl(ID:=2071).accDoDefaultAction

D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er70
DoCmd.RunSQL "insert into ArşivT select * from VeriT Where VeriT.Kimlik=[Forms]![VeriF]![Kimlik]"
DoCmd.RunSQL "delete from veriT Where VeriT.Kimlik=[Forms]![VeriF]![Kimlik]"
Me.Requery
DoCmd.GoToRecord , , acNewRec
End Sub 


bir de böyle denediniz mi?

İnadına, ille de Accesstr.net...
Cevapla


kahraman701
Üye
Kullanici Avatari
Üye
21
7
08/11/2008
0
Ankara
Ofis XP
05/02/2012,19:27
Çözüldü 
HOCAM SAĞOLUN AMA MALESEF AYNI HATAYI VERDİFur
Cevapla


Puletin
Uzman
Kullanici Avatari
Uzman
1.716
01/11/2008
416
Ülke Dışı
Ofis 2003
29/10/2016,20:35
Çözüldü 
Mehmet Hocanın gönderdiği kod çalışıyor bakınız....

Bu arada Örnek için CELOYCE hocama teşekkürler...


Ek Dosyalar
.rar   Arşiv örneği.rar (Dosya Boyutu: 18,04 KB / İndirme Sayısı: 55)
Kaplumbağa ya dikkat et...
Sadece başını çıkartıp risk aldığında ilerleyebiliyor...
Cevapla


kahraman701
Üye
Kullanici Avatari
Üye
21
7
08/11/2008
0
Ankara
Ofis XP
05/02/2012,19:27
Çözüldü 
benim problemim arşive gönderdikten sonra otamatik sayının sıfırlanmaması, yoksa kaydı arşive gönderiyor onda bir sorun yok... teşekkürler
Cevapla


tdsharun
>>> O Şimdi Sivil<<<
Kullanici Avatari
Aktif Üye
778
06/11/2008
225
Kütahya
Ofis 2003
31/12/2011,02:16
Çözüldü 
Bu şekilde otomatik sayı sıfırlanmaz. Otomatik sayıyı sıfırlamak için birden fazla yöntem var ancak bunun için ayrıca birkaç tane işlem yapmak gerekiyor. Otomatik Sayı dinamik bir yapıya sahiptir. Bir kaydı yaptınız ve sonra sildiniz diyelim. Aldığı otomatik sayı 1 ise, bundan sonra açacağınız yeni kayıt 2 olarak açılır otomatik olarak. 1 numaralı kaydı silmiş olmanıza rağmen bundan sonraki kayıtlar en son kullandığınız otomatik sayı değerinin bir fazlası olarak açılır. Siz 43. kaydı sildiğinizde 44. kayıt 43 olmaz. O 44 olarak kalmaya devam eder. 43 nolu kaydı da bir daha kullanamazsınız...

Tabi buraya kadar anlattıklarım bu işin normal koşulları. Otomatik sayıyı değiştirmek için başka başka yöntemler var. Bunun için yazılmış kodlar var. Yeni açtığınız kayıtları önceki boşlukları doldurarak yapan ve otomatik sayının boş kalmadan sırasıyla yapılmasını sağlayan bir örneği Mehmetdemiral hocam ekledi geçenlerde.

Ayrıca bununla ilgili forumda arama yapmanızı tavsiye ederim. Tabi otomatik sayıyı değiştirmekte ısrarcıysanız...

Kolay gelsin...
Cevapla







Konuyu Okuyanlar: 1 Ziyaretçi


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Tarih Son Yorum
  Oluşturmuş Olduğum Forma Bilgi Ekleyemiyorum ve İçerisinde Arama Yapamıyorum. zgr54 4 319 15/05/2016, 22:18 zgr54
Çözüldü Kesilen faturaları arşive kaldırmak kenan827 6 529 17/01/2016, 18:06 kenan827
Çözüldü raporu excel yoluyla mail ile gönderirken oluşan sorun mehmetb84 2 454 09/01/2016, 02:19 mehmetb84
Çözüldü Arşive gönderirken Güncelleme sorunu. fascioğlu 4 581 14/10/2015, 00:42 fascioğlu
Çözüldü Veri kayıt yapamıyorum gencerker 7 700 09/05/2015, 16:52 gencerker


Türkçe Çeviri: MCTR, Forum Yazılımı: MyBB, © 2002-2016 MyBB Group.
DMCA.com Protection Status
© Desing by XSTYLED| Develops by ozanakkaya